Arjun Hari Bhalerao Full name : Arjun Hari Jagtap (stage name: Shahir Arjun Hari Bhalerao) Born : 1 December 1932 , Bhalerao Wadi (near Shrirampur), Ahmednagar district, Maharashtra Died : 27 November 2004, Pune Community : Mahar (Scheduled Caste / Dalit) Occupation : Shahir (folk poet-singer), Powada and Lavani performer, social activist, playwright Early Life – From Village Boy to Voice of Resistance Born into a landless Mahar family in rural Ahmednagar, Arjun grew up witnessing extreme caste oppression and poverty. His father Hari was a farm labourer; the family lived in the traditional Maharwada (Dalit settlement) outside the village. Like most Mahar children of the 1930s–40s, he faced untouchability daily: barred from village wells, temples, and schools. He studied only up to Class 4 because the school refused to let Mahar children sit inside the classroom. Instead, they were made to sit outside on the veranda.
